Just bought a 99 379 with an ultra cab and 63 inch stand up. Is the ultra cab hole bigger than a regular cab sleeper? I have a 36inch flat top im going to swap out for the 63. will the hole line up or will i have to get a new roof cap for the truck?

The hole is bigger. So new roof cap for the cab or sleeper one of the two. I know there is a company that does flat top conversions for the 48, 63, and 70" ultracabs but not sure if they could do a taller roof for a 36" flat top.
